A poet and a thief meet at Alliance Francaise

The Man on the Train (L'homme Du Train) French comic-drama directed by Patrice Leconte will be screened at 3.00 pm on Tuesday April 15 and 6.30 pm on Wednesday April 16 at Alliance Francaise, Barnes Place Colombo-7.

A man, Milan (played by Johnny Halliday) steps off a train, into a small French village. As he waits for the day when he will rob the town bank, he runs into an old retired poetry teacher named M. Manesquier (Jean Rochefort). The two men strike up a strange friendship and explore the road not taken, each wanting to live the other's life.

This 2002 which was shot in Annonay, France, won the audience awards at the Venice Film Festival for ‘Best Film’ and ‘Best Actor’ (Jean Rochefort) in 2002. It stars Jean Rochefort and Johnny Hallyday in the lead.
